修改火狐扩展之自定义hackbar
自從hackbar收費(fèi)之后,白嫖黨就開始另尋它路
有破解hackbar的,有使用它的替代品的
這里我用的是這個(gè)
它這里能自動(dòng)添加各種語句是十分方便的功能
可是發(fā)現(xiàn)竟然沒有常用的mysql查詢表,字段
然后就有了魔改插件的念頭
去這里看一下擴(kuò)展是怎么做的
https://developer.mozilla.org/zh-CN/docs/Mozilla/Add-ons/WebExtensions/Your_first_WebExtension
找到原來的擴(kuò)展文件
打開文件夾
找到你想修改的擴(kuò)展
因?yàn)闆]有名字不確定哪個(gè)是hackbar
我索性把hackbar移除重裝了,然后看日期
把文件拖出來,修改后綴為zip
然后解壓文件得到整個(gè)文件夾
接下來就是看它的代碼部分了
目錄結(jié)構(gòu)簡單明了
現(xiàn)在實(shí)現(xiàn)在SQL里添加一項(xiàng)mysqltables用來爆表
1.在html里添加選項(xiàng)
紅色框里是我添加的選項(xiàng)
記住它的name,邏輯處理的時(shí)候要用
2.在js里添加邏輯處理部分
在hackbar.js里添加
可以看到上面的代碼調(diào)用了SQL.selectionToMysqlTables()
所以還需在SQL.js里添加selectionToMysqlTables()
哈?你問我怎么知道該添加什么的
類比不會(huì)么
然后開始打包成zip
修改zip后綴為xpi
現(xiàn)在直接拖到火狐會(huì)提示
下面這個(gè)鏈接提供了幾種解決辦法
firefox未簽名認(rèn)證擴(kuò)展解決辦法 整理
我自己嘗試過前幾種都已失敗告終
好像只剩下自己給它加簽名了
先用另一種方法測(cè)試
訪問about:debugging
點(diǎn)擊此firefox
然后選擇你修改后的xpi文件就行了
看下效果圖
定制自己專屬的hackbar
留給師傅們自己去探索了
總結(jié)
以上是生活随笔為你收集整理的修改火狐扩展之自定义hackbar的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 极客时间 Redis核心技术与实战 笔记
- 下一篇: luogu P4408 [NOI2003